Tips
To further enrich the learning experience after reading the book about volcanoes, encourage the student to create a volcano model using household materials. This hands-on activity will reinforce the concepts learned and allow for creativity in showcasing the volcanic process. Additionally, engage in discussions about the impact of volcanoes on the environment and human settlements to broaden the child's perspective on the topic.
